Morphological Observation On The Choroid Plexus And Epiplexus Cells Of Rat Lateral Ventricles

Cerebrospinal fluid(CSF)circulation,known as human third circulation,plays an very important role in the pathogenesis and prevention of the central nervous system disease such as hydrocephalus,cranial pressure,intracranial hemorrhage,subarachnoid hemorrhage.The ventricular system choroid plexus,especially lateral ventricle choroid plexus,is the main place of produce cerebrospinal fluid,the cerebrospinal fluid accounts for about 80% ~ 85% of the total and also the main site of the blood-brain barrier.The central nervous diseases such as Alzheimer disease(AD),may be close relationship with cerebrospinal fluid circulation is normal or not.The structural changes of choroid plexus,will directly affect the production of cerebrospinal fluid,resulting in CSF circulation obstacle.Object: To observe the subtle and ultra-structural characteristics of the rat lateral ventricle choroid plexus and epiplexus cells,providing morphological basis to explore its functional meaning.Methods:1 Experimental animals and materialsChoosen five adult male SD rats,10 months,weight 250-300 g,provided by animal experiment center of Hebei Medical University.Rats were drawn by aortic perfusion fixation for light and electron microscope preparation of tissue samples.2 Sample preparation and observation for light microscopeThe aldehyde fixative fixed rat brain is given the concentration gradient from low to high ethanol dehydration,hyalinized xylene,embedded in paraffin,tissue sections,and then do routine HE staining and observe by light microscope,to show the fine structural characteristics of lateral ventricle choroid plexus.3 Sample preparation and observation for SEMThe tissue samples of fixed choroid plexus,then prepare the conventional scanning electron microscope(SEM)sample.By scanning electron microscope,reveal the surface structural characteristics of rat choroid plexus.4 Sample preparation and observation for TEMTake aldehyde fixed choroid plexus tissue samples for routine transmitssion electron microscope(TEM)sample preparation,observation on the ultra-thin tissue slice by transmission electron microscope,reveal the ultrastructural features of the choroid plexus and epiplexus cells.Results:1 HE stained paraffin embedded tissue sections by light microscope observation showed that: The structure of the rat choroid plexus has three components: capillary network in the center,around for connective tissue,the outer most cover with ependymal epithelium so as choroid plexus epithelium.Capillary lumen is irregular,pipe diameter sizes and tube wall surrounded by monolayer endothelial cells,endothelial cell nuclei in fusiform,often convex to the lumen.The surrounding stroma cells in the connective tissue.Choroid plexus epithelial cells arranged closely,a short columnar or cuboidal,larger nucleus,round and dyeing uniform.2 SEM observation showed that: on the surface of rat lateral ventricle choroid plexus,there present parallel arranged as fold or crest sample forms.Closely packed between each choroid plexus epithelial cell,its free surface(ventricular surface)irregular shape,round,oval,or polygon.Observed under magnification,the free surface of choroid plexus epithelial cells was a large gathering of microvilli,including a few numbers of cilia.The epiplexus cells prostrate on the surface of microvillus,shaped like a spider,the pseudopodia sample protrusions from the cell body.3 TEM observation showed that: there are gap junctions between rat lateral ventricle choroid plexus adjacent epithelial cells,near the free edge is closely connected.The epiplexus cells protruding pseudopodia prostrate on the microvilli.In the epiplexus cell,often existing a large number of primary lysosome,secondary lysosomes or phagosome.Conclusion: The observation shows that rat choroid plexus is composed of three kinds of structural components: the capillaries as the center,surrounding the loose connective tissue around,appearance is lined by choroid plexus epithelium.There were a lot of microvilli on the free surface of choroid plexus epithelial cells,which have active secretion function.There was close connection between the top of adjacent epithelial cells,blocking intercellular space was considered as the main structural basis of blood-brain barrier.Epiplexus cells as strangers in the land of intraventricular mononuclear macrophage system,is responsible for cleaning up the harmful material of the cerebrospinal fluid.
